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) Job Description
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
§ Is visible and available to residents and aware of their location, including sign out status,
at all times.
§ Escorts residents through building.
§ Converses with residents to promote social interaction and provide emotional support.
§ Assists with personal hygiene and grooming (bathing, toileting, hair care, mouth care,
skin care, nail care, dressing and undressing).
§ Greets, seats, takes meal orders of residents entering the dining room.
§ Assists with set up and cleaning of dining area, i.e. setting tables, clearing and cleaning
tables, refilling condiments, wrapping silverware, preparing coffee/tea etc.
§ Serves meals, delivers meal trays to resident units, assists with meals and snacks as
necessary.
§ Maintains a clean and orderly environment.
§ Performs general housekeeping duties daily, i.e. making of bed, changing bed and bath
linens, hanging up clothes and cleaning apartments as scheduled.
§ Performs laundry duties as scheduled, i.e. washing, drying and folding laundry.
§ Assists residents with self-administration of prescribed and over-the counter medication
in accordance with medication guidelines and record resident’s self-administration of
medication appropriately. Maintains daily up-to-date medication observation record
(MOR) for each resident.
§ Follows Resident Functional Evaluation and Service Plan “RFE” for all assigned
residents per working shift.
§ Completes written reports and routine resident record reviews and updates as scheduled.
§ Documents and reports incidents, unusual occurrences, and observations of changes in
resident health or behavior timely and accurately.
§ Maintains confidentiality regarding residents’ personal and health information and
respect residents’ privacy. Adheres to the resident bill of rights as defined by State law.
§ Contains disruptive behavior to prevent injury to themselves and others.
§ Escorts residents to social activities and encourages participation.
§ Assists with implementation or coordination of planned activities as needed. May
accompany residents on outings.
§ Responds promptly and positively to resident requests for assistance, including
emergency calls and phone calls.
§ Responds to needs of families and visitors by providing immediate assistance.
§ Assists with resident move-ins and move-outs.
§ Demonstrates courteous, polite, professional attitude with residents, families, visitors and
co-workers.
§ Ensures safe work environment by following established guidelines regarding infection
control and safe practice and by reporting hazards.

§ Minimizes own health risk by performing duties in accordance with established
guidelines, i.e. using proper body mechanics when lifting and bending.
§ Follows designated plan of action in the event of fire or other emergency situation.
§ Performs all duties in accordance with company policy and procedures as well as federal
and/or state laws and regulations.
§ Attends required staff meetings and in-service training.
§ Performs other duties as assigned.
